Performance optimization in SAP systems is a critical aspect of maintaining efficient business operations. As organizations increasingly rely on SAP for their core business processes, ensuring optimal system performance becomes paramount. This technical deep dive explores comprehensive strategies and best practices for optimizing SAP system performance across various dimensions.

Database performance forms the foundation of SAP system optimization. Modern SAP systems, particularly those running on HANA, require specific optimization techniques to achieve optimal performance. This includes proper sizing of memory areas, optimizing table partitioning strategies, and implementing effective data archiving policies.

Application server optimization involves multiple aspects, from workload distribution to memory management. Proper sizing and configuration of work processes ensure efficient handling of user requests. Buffer settings must be optimized based on workload patterns and available resources.

Network performance significantly impacts end-user experience and system responsiveness. Organizations must implement proper network segmentation and quality of service policies to ensure critical SAP traffic receives appropriate priority. Network latency between different system components should be minimized.
